Apple is currently putting in a lot of work on the new iOS 17 system. Recent tweets from @analyst941 reveal the alleged look of the iOS 17 wallet and health app.

Wallet App

In the iOS 17 wallet app, there is a new navigation bar at the bottom. It also comes with five options which include Cards, Cash, Keys, IDs, and Orders.

iOS 17 wallet

The main features of the wallet app are as follows:

  • Swipe down to search anywhere
  • Sort tags based on user needs – easy sorting of tabs
  • Apple Cash/Savings gets its own tab
  • New ā€œAll transactionsā€ button

He also adds that there is much more on the app that is not in the image above. Thus we can expect more from the new Wallet App.

Health App

The report also claims thatĀ Apple will redesign the “Favorites” section under “Summary” with a card-style interface. Each card has “visual data,” including “colour charts,” “tables,” and other info.Ā Since the Summary tab in the Health app also includes trends and highlights, it’s unclear how Apple will adjust the layout.

The iOS Wallet App: A Secure and Convenient Payment Method

The iOS Wallet app is a digital wallet that allows users to store payment info, cards, and other essential documents securely. The app supports credit and debit cards, Apple Pay, and various other payment methods. Adding cards to the wallet is a breeze. Users can add cards by taking a picture of them or entering the details manually. Also, the app allows users to add funds to their Apple Pay Cash account, which they can use to make buys or send money to other Apple Pay users.

Apple Wallet

The Wallet app’s ease cannot be overstated. Users can pay for goods and services quickly and easily without having to carry physical cards or cash. The app also allows users to store and access digital tickets, boarding passes, and other essential documents. In addition to convenience, the app offers robust security features, such as Touch ID and Face ID authentication, to ensure that only authorized users can access the stored info.

Apple’s desire for user privacy is evident in the Wallet app’s security features. The app encrypts and stores the user’s credit and debit card details on the device’s secure element. This encryption ensures that the user’s sensitive financial info is protected from prying eyes. Apple Pay is also more secure than traditional payment methods. When making a payment, Apple Pay assigns a unique Device Account Number (DAN) to the transaction instead of the user’s credit or debit card number. This DAN ensures that the user’s financial information is never shared with the merchant, and their transactions remain secure.

The iOS Health App: A Comprehensive Health Tracker

The iOS Health app is a detailed health tracker that allows users to monitor their fitness and wellbeing. It collect data from various sources, such as the user’s iPhone, Apple Watch, and third-party apps, to provide a holistic view of their health. Users can track their daily activity, heart rate, sleep patterns, and other health metrics using the app. The app also offers features that help users manage specific health conditions. For example, users with diabetes can use the app to track their blood glucose levels and receive personalized insights and recommendations based on their data. Similarly, users with high blood pressure can use the app to track their blood pressure readings and monitor their medication intake.

One of the biggest benefits of using the iOS Health app is that it empowers users to take an active role in managing their health. By providing users with personalized insights and recommendations, the app helps them make informed decisions about their health and wellbeing. The app also integrates with various third-party health and fitness apps, allowing users to access a wide range of features and services. For example, the app can integrate with wearable fitness trackers like Fitbit or Garmin, allowing users to monitor their fitness levels and daily activity.

The iOS Health app’s privacy features are also pretty decent. Users have complete control over the data they share with the app and can choose which data points they want to track. The app’s privacy settings allow users to control which apps have access to their health data and how that data is used. Its data is also encrypted and stored locally on the user’s device, ensuring that the user’s sensitive health info remains private and secure.
